
Over the past 15 years, Indian real estate has attracted an impressive $80 billion in investments, with foreign investors contributing a staggering 57% of that total. The allure of India’s burgeoning economy, coupled with its evolving urban landscape, has catalyzed substantial interest from global investors.
This significant influx of foreign capital has not only bolstered the real estate market but also contributed to the overall economic growth of the nation. With urbanization on the rise, India presents unique opportunities for investment in residential, commercial, and industrial properties.
